WebThe National Defense Authorization Act (NDAA) for Fiscal Year 2024 set forth significant reforms including the consolidation of authorities under Title 10 U.S. Code, Chapter 16, … WebMar 14, 2024 · The Management of Security Cooperation (Green Book) The basic textbook employed by the Defense Institute of Security Assistance Management (DISAM) for instruction covering the full range of security assistance activities. The text is revised annually and commonly referred to as the "Green Book" as it is bound in a green cover. WebThis annually revised publication is used by Defense Institute of Security Cooperation Studies to help in understanding the policy, precedent and procedure of security cooperation activities. It is an academic document and should not be construed as representing official policies of the U.S. government. boots bock
